Knight Foundation pledges support for Drupal (again)

The Knight Foundation, http://www.knightfoundation.org, which has contributed over $1,000,000 in it’s history for technological innovation of CMS platforms, has pledged to support Drupal in the coming year. It has not earmarked an amount or a specific set of functionality, but it is allowing the Drupal community itself to decide what gets built and how much they will get to build it.


Via it’s page on http://groups.drupal.org the Knight Foundation will be accepting proposals for the work and the amount contributed, and via a community process it will grant funds to Drupal development projects for the general advancement of the platform.


The Knight Foundation has identified as it’s goal to bring Drupal (and other technology platforms) to the people. Not to the developers, but to the actual end users. Make it so easy to use, that everyone can set it up and use it. Some very intriguing things are sure to come about from this.
